Good ideas are not hard to find. But only those ideas that can be implemented into new, unprecedented applications become innovations. Those wanting to develop innovative products must therefore be able to think outside the box of their own area of expertise. 'Fraunhofer's strength lies in interaction. When the Institutes pool their competencies, the result is enormous potential for innovation,' as Dr Michael Popall from the Fraunhofer Institute for Silicate Research ISC in Wuerzburg, Germany knows. The team is developing new nanotech products in cooperation with researchers at various Fraunhofer Institutes. Some of these products can be seen from 18 to 20 February 2009 at this year's nano tech in Tokyo, Big Sight East, Building 5, Booth C21...
